Output 156af48868f80c7a9ded2c61b1ba75d6316fdec9fc254962a8a85ad169d1a28c:0

value
641556
script pubkey
OP_HASH160 OP_PUSHBYTES_20 349210dc1142067bbb66b5ea87446b228dd95025 OP_EQUAL
address
36Uz3MQdPTNhBmVFXiT5zDfCu7y2okFz3e
transaction
156af48868f80c7a9ded2c61b1ba75d6316fdec9fc254962a8a85ad169d1a28c
spent
true